Organize Your Rings With DIY Monogrammed Ring Cones

Whether you prefer delicate stacked rings, bold baubles or sweet and sentimental rings, you need to keep them organized. For a long time, my rings were scattered all over the place… until now! DIY monogrammed ring cones are super easy to make and useful too. All you need is a little clay, paint and glaze to get a faux ceramic look for a fraction of the price!

Materials and Tools:
— oven-bake clay
— acrylic paint
— paint brush and/or Q-tips
— alphabet rubber stamps
— glazing medium
— sandpaper
